In a region of interest (roi) machine vision system, the region of interest refers to a specific area within an image that you select for detailed analysis. This concept allows you to focus on the most relevant portions of visual data while ignoring unnecessary parts. By narrowing the focus, ROI helps reduce data processing requirements and improves accuracy. For example, Nugaliyadde et al. demonstrated how relying on CNN-extracted features improved detection accuracy to 91% when analyzing medical images. This targeted approach ensures you can identify critical details, such as an object in motion or defects in a product, without being distracted by irrelevant information.
In a region of interest (roi) machine vision system, focusing on specific areas of an image significantly boosts computational efficiency. When you analyze only the relevant portions of an image, the system processes less data. This reduction in workload allows the system to operate faster and allocate resources more effectively. For example, instead of scanning an entire image for an object, the system can narrow its focus to a smaller area where the object is likely to appear. This targeted approach minimizes unnecessary computations and ensures quicker detection.
Additionally, ROIs streamline various stages of image processing, such as segmentation and feature extraction. By concentrating on specific regions, you can avoid wasting time and resources on irrelevant parts of the image. This efficiency becomes especially important in real-time applications, where speed is critical for success.
ROIs play a vital role in improving the accuracy of machine vision systems. By focusing on the most relevant areas, you can eliminate distractions and ensure the system analyzes only the critical details. For instance, when detecting defects in a product, narrowing the focus to the region where defects are most likely to occur increases the chances of accurate detection.
This precision is particularly useful in applications like object detection, where identifying the correct object is crucial. By reducing the scope of analysis, you can improve the system's ability to differentiate between relevant and irrelevant data, leading to more reliable results.
Noise and irrelevant data often hinder the performance of machine vision systems. ROIs help you tackle this challenge by isolating the areas of interest and ignoring the rest. For example, in facial recognition systems, focusing on the face rather than the background eliminates unnecessary information that could confuse the system.
By reducing noise, ROIs improve the clarity of the data being analyzed. This clarity ensures that the system can focus on the essential features, such as the shape or texture of an object. As a result, you can achieve more accurate detection and analysis, even in complex environments.
In object detection and tracking, regions of interest (ROIs) play a pivotal role in identifying and following objects within images or video frames. By narrowing the focus to specific areas, you can improve both the speed and accuracy of detection. For instance, the Faster R-CNN model uses a region proposal network (RPN) to generate ROIs efficiently. This approach reduces computation time to approximately 10 milliseconds per image, making it ideal for real-time applications.
ROIs also enhance object localization by isolating the relevant portions of an image. This isolation ensures that the system can accurately identify the position and boundaries of an object. In scenarios like traffic monitoring, ROIs help track vehicles or pedestrians while ignoring irrelevant background elements. Similarly, in sports analytics, they enable precise tracking of players or equipment, such as a ball in motion.
By integrating ROIs into object detection systems, you can achieve faster processing, better object localization, and improved instance segmentation. These benefits make ROIs indispensable in applications requiring high precision and efficiency.
In manufacturing, ROIs are essential for quality inspection processes. They allow you to focus on critical areas of a product, ensuring that defects or inconsistencies are detected with high accuracy. For example, chi-square tests have been used to identify critical control points in manufacturing workflows. These tests help pinpoint stages where defects are most likely to occur, enabling targeted improvements.
ROIs also optimize segmentation by isolating specific regions of a product for detailed analysis. This targeted approach reduces the chances of missing defects and ensures consistent quality. Case studies highlight innovative solutions like a box-sorting machine vision system that verifies key components. Another example includes a 3D vision robot guidance solution developed for an automaker, showcasing how ROIs enhance precision in industrial applications.
The growing need for automated inspection and quality control drives the adoption of ROI-based systems. By focusing on relevant areas, you can reduce defect rates, improve process optimization, and enhance overall product quality.
Facial recognition and biometric systems rely heavily on ROIs to analyze specific features, such as eyes, nose, and mouth. By focusing on these regions, you can eliminate irrelevant data, such as background noise, and improve the accuracy of detection. For example, in facial recognition, ROIs help isolate the face from the rest of the image, ensuring that the system analyzes only the relevant features.
Biometric systems also benefit from ROIs by enhancing segmentation and feature extraction. For instance, fingerprint recognition systems use ROIs to focus on the ridges and patterns of a fingerprint, ignoring unnecessary details. Similarly, iris recognition systems analyze the unique patterns within the iris, ensuring precise identification.
The adoption of ROI-based systems in biometric applications continues to grow, driven by the need for secure and efficient identification methods. By focusing on specific regions, you can achieve higher accuracy and reliability in these systems, making them suitable for various applications, from security to healthcare.
Medical imaging plays a vital role in diagnosing diseases and monitoring patient health. By using regions of interest (ROIs), you can focus on specific areas within medical images, such as X-rays, MRIs, or CT scans, to improve diagnostic accuracy. This targeted approach allows you to analyze critical details while ignoring irrelevant parts of the image.
AI-powered tools have revolutionized medical imaging by leveraging ROIs for advanced analysis. For example, segmentation techniques help isolate organs, tissues, or abnormalities within an image. This process ensures that you can identify patterns or anomalies with greater precision. Deep learning models, such as Convolutional Neural Networks (CNNs), excel at analyzing detailed medical images. These models use ROIs to detect subtle changes, like early signs of cancer or microfractures in bones, that might otherwise go unnoticed.
Tip: Accurate annotation is essential for AI models to perform well. Techniques like bounding boxes and semantic segmentation ensure precise labeling of medical images. Bounding boxes classify objects, while semantic segmentation provides pixel-level accuracy, making it easier to identify abnormalities.
The benefits of ROIs extend beyond accuracy. They also reduce the computational load by narrowing the focus to relevant areas. For instance, when analyzing an MRI scan, you can use ROIs to concentrate on a specific organ, such as the brain or heart. This approach speeds up processing and delivers faster results, which is crucial in emergency situations.
The table below highlights how ROIs enhance medical imaging and diagnostics:
Evidence Description | Key Points |
---|---|
AI-powered image annotation enhances diagnostic accuracy through regions of interest | Segmentation and classification improve precision in medical diagnostics. |
Machine learning identifies complex patterns in large datasets | Helps diagnose various conditions by analyzing patterns in medical imaging. |
Deep learning uses neural networks for advanced image analysis | Convolutional Neural Networks (CNNs) are effective for detailed medical images like MRIs. |
Annotation process is crucial for AI model accuracy | Involves thorough data collection, effective labeling techniques, and strict quality control. |
Labeling techniques include bounding boxes and semantic segmentation | Bounding boxes classify objects, while semantic segmentation provides pixel-level precision. |
By integrating ROIs into medical imaging systems, you can achieve faster, more accurate diagnoses. This approach not only improves patient outcomes but also enhances the efficiency of healthcare systems. Whether you're analyzing a tumor's growth or monitoring a patient's recovery, ROIs ensure that you focus on the most critical details.
Manual selection allows you to define regions of interest (ROIs) by directly marking areas within an image or video feed. This technique works well when you need precise control over the analysis. For example, in object detection tasks, you can manually highlight specific objects or areas where detection is required. This approach ensures accuracy in applications like quality inspection, where you must focus on critical product features.
Manual selection is straightforward but time-consuming. It requires human intervention, which limits scalability in systems handling large datasets or real-time video feeds. However, it remains valuable for scenarios where automated methods struggle to identify ROIs accurately, such as analyzing complex medical images or detecting subtle defects in manufacturing.
Automated ROI detection uses algorithms to identify relevant areas within an image or video feed without human input. These algorithms rely on techniques like convolutional neural networks (CNNs) and deep learning models to analyze patterns and features. For instance, CNNs excel at object localization by isolating specific regions where objects appear.
Performance metrics like Mean Average Precision (AP) and Dice Similarity Coefficient (DSC) validate the accuracy of automated ROI detection. These metrics ensure the system minimizes errors in object localization and segmentation. In dynamic environments, such as maritime monitoring, automated ROI systems achieve real-time processing speeds while maintaining high accuracy. This adaptability makes them ideal for applications requiring rapid detection and analysis.
Dynamic ROI adjustment allows systems to modify regions of interest in response to changing conditions. This technique is essential for real-time applications, where data evolves rapidly. For example, in video feeds, dynamic adjustment helps track moving objects or adapt to shifts in lighting conditions.
AI-powered analytics enhance the speed and accuracy of dynamic ROI systems. These systems integrate multi-channel data to provide a holistic view of interactions, enabling quick adjustments. For instance, a social media monitoring tool can detect spikes in user sentiment and adjust its focus accordingly. Metrics like processing speed and real-time decision-making highlight the benefits of dynamic ROI adjustment, ensuring timely responses to changes in data trends.
By leveraging dynamic ROI adjustment, you can improve instance segmentation and object detection in fast-paced environments. This approach reduces computational load while maintaining high performance, making it indispensable for competitive industries.
Regions of interest (ROIs) help you reduce the computational load by narrowing the focus to specific areas within an image or video feed. This targeted approach minimizes the amount of data the system processes, allowing faster detection and analysis. For example, when analyzing a video feed for object detection, focusing on ROIs eliminates the need to scan the entire frame. This reduction in workload speeds up processing and ensures timely results.
In real-world scenarios, ROIs streamline tasks like segmentation and classification. A study extracted 3043 clips of ROIs for classification under variable conditions. The dataset included 358 positive elements and 2685 negative ones, demonstrating how ROIs improve system performance even in challenging environments. By concentrating on relevant areas, you can achieve faster processing without compromising accuracy.
ROIs enhance your ability to focus on the most relevant data within an image. By isolating specific regions, you can eliminate distractions and improve the clarity of the analysis. For instance, in object detection tasks, ROIs help you locate and analyze the object while ignoring irrelevant background elements. This focused approach ensures the system prioritizes critical details, such as shape, texture, or movement.
When applied to segmentation, ROIs allow precise localization of objects within an image. This precision is particularly useful in applications like traffic monitoring, where identifying vehicles or pedestrians is crucial. By concentrating on relevant data, you can improve the reliability of detection systems and ensure better decision-making.
Using ROIs significantly boosts the performance and accuracy of machine vision systems. By focusing on specific areas, you reduce noise and irrelevant data, which often interfere with analysis results. For example, in facial recognition systems, ROIs isolate the face from the background, ensuring accurate detection of features like eyes and mouth.
ROIs also enhance object localization by pinpointing the exact position and boundaries of an object. This improvement leads to better segmentation and classification, even in complex environments. The extraction of ROIs under variable conditions, as demonstrated in the study, highlights their reliability in maintaining high performance levels. By integrating ROIs into your system, you can achieve consistent accuracy and optimize overall functionality.
Defining accurate regions of interest (ROIs) in machine vision systems often presents significant challenges. Many organizations struggle due to a lack of expertise in artificial intelligence. Without skilled professionals, implementing deep learning solutions becomes difficult. Additionally, the high costs of managing and storing data can hinder progress. Another common issue is the lack of quality data, particularly images of defective parts, which complicates training models effectively.
Dynamic imaging systems introduce further complexities. For example, integrating datasets from different sources can be slow and challenging for non-experts. Aligning imaging modalities often leads to co-registration issues, where differences in spatial resolution or artifacts create discrepancies. Tailoring data analysis to reflect the unique properties of each modality adds another layer of difficulty. These challenges highlight the importance of careful planning and resource allocation when defining ROIs.
Balancing the size of an ROI with system performance is crucial for achieving optimal results. A region that is too large may include irrelevant data, increasing computational load and reducing efficiency. Conversely, a region that is too small risks missing critical details, compromising accuracy.
Research shows that companies monitoring their performance against benchmarks see a 20-30% improvement in ROI. This underscores the importance of informed decision-making. Metrics play a key role here. Without them, optimizing performance becomes guesswork. By carefully evaluating key performance indicators, you can align ROI size with system requirements, ensuring both efficiency and accuracy.
To define effective ROIs, you should follow several best practices. First, prioritize high-quality data. Ensure your dataset includes diverse and representative samples, especially for object detection tasks. Second, use automated tools to assist with ROI localization. Algorithms like convolutional neural networks (CNNs) can identify relevant regions with high precision. Third, regularly evaluate your system’s performance. Adjust ROI parameters based on metrics like processing speed and accuracy to maintain optimal results.
Finally, consider the intersection of ROI size and system capabilities. A well-defined ROI should balance computational efficiency with the need for detailed analysis. By following these practices, you can improve system performance and achieve reliable results in applications like object detection and localization.
Regions of interest play a vital role in machine vision systems. They help you focus on the most relevant parts of an image, improving accuracy and reducing processing time. By narrowing the scope of analysis, you can optimize system performance and achieve faster results. For example, advanced frame grabbers like CoaXPress and Camera Link enhance ROI functionality. These tools offer features such as real-time compression and programmable ROIs, as shown below:
Frame Grabber Type | Key Features |
---|---|
CoaXPress | High-end acquisition, real-time compression, offloading ROIs for bandwidth utilization |
Camera Link | Programmable ROIs, pixel decimation, image scaling, lookup tables |
Integrating regions of interest into your machine vision design ensures better efficiency and precision. Make ROI a core component of your system to unlock its full potential.
ROI pooling is a technique used in machine vision to extract fixed-size feature maps from regions of interest. It divides each ROI into a grid and applies max pooling to each cell. This method ensures consistent input size for subsequent layers, improving detection performance.
ROI align eliminates the quantization errors present in ROI pooling. It uses bilinear interpolation to compute precise feature values for each region of interest. This approach enhances accuracy, especially in tasks like object detection and segmentation.
Yes, ROI techniques focus on specific areas, such as lanes or intersections, to improve vehicle count accuracy. By isolating regions where vehicles are likely to appear, you can reduce noise and enhance detection performance in multi lane intersection scenarios.
ROI helps track vehicles by narrowing the focus to relevant areas, such as roads or parking lots. This targeted approach reduces computational load and improves accuracy, making it easier to monitor vehicle movement in real-time.
Dynamic ROI adjustment allows systems to adapt to changing conditions, such as lighting or object movement. For example, in a multi lane intersection, the system can modify regions of interest to track vehicles accurately, even during peak traffic hours.
Fundamental Principles of Edge Detection in Machine Vision
Essential Insights Into Computer Vision and Machine Vision
Understanding Image Processing in Machine Vision Systems